Akira's Katsuhiro Otomo Unveils Short Peace Film Teaser

posted on by Egan Loo
Freedom's Morita, 5 Numbers' Ando, Gundam's Katoki, Animatrix's Morimoto, Redline's Ishii, Evangelion's Sadamoto contribute

Short Peace, the omnibus of four shorts by Katsuhiro Ōtomo (Akira, Memories, Steamboy) and other leading anime creators, will open in Japan on July 20. The official website began streaming a teaser trailer.





The four shorts are:

"Combustible" ("Hi-no-youjin")
Screenplay, Director: Katsuhiro Ōtomo
Character Design, Visual Concept: Hidekazu Ohara
Music: Makoto Kubota

"Tsukumo"
Screenplay, Director: Shuhei Morita (Kakurenbo, Freedom)
Original Story Concept, Conceptual Design: Keisuke Kishi

"Gambo"
Director: Hiroaki Ando (Five Numbers!)
Original Story Concept, Screenplay, Creative Director: Katsuhito Ishii (Redline, Funky Forest: The First Contact, Taste of Tea)
Character Design: Yoshiyuki Sadamoto (Evangelion, .hack, Summer Wars)

"Buki yo Saraba"
Original Story: Katsuhiro Ōtomo
Screenplay, Director: Hajime Katoki (mechanical designs in Gundam franchise, Super Robot Wars)
Character Design: Tatsuyuki Tanaka (Tojin Kit)

In addition, Kōji Morimoto (The Animatrix's Beyond, Noiseman Sound Insect, Genius Party's Dimension Bomb) contributed the film's opening animation.

Short Peace is an omnibus project assembling "top creators at the leading edge of Japanese animation, exploring possible future avenues of expression." Short Peace is also the title of a collection of Otomo's manga shorts that was first published in the 1970s. Yasumasa Tsuchiya is producing the shorts at Sunrise.

"Combustible" already debuted in a preview screening in Japan last April, and the Annecy Film Festival in France presented both "Combustible" and "Tsukumo" last June. "Combustible" also played at the Platform International Animation Festival in Los Angeles in October. The short won the Grand Prize in the Animation division of the 16th Japan Media Arts Festival Awards and the Noburou Oofuji Award in the 67th Annual Mainichi Film Awards.
